Noun

owner (plural owners)

  1. One who owns something.
    The police recovered the stolen car and returned it to its owner.
    • 2012, Sherri Lackey, The Vrykolakas Deviation (page 117)
      Sometimes the sound was close, as the owner of the voice was wandering just on the outside walls of his living quarters.
  2. (nautical, slang) The captain of a ship.

Synonyms

  • (one who owns): possessor, proprietor (of a business, etc)
